Understanding the Layer-1 for SportFi

Chiliz Chain is the foundation of a growing new category in blockchain: SportFi. As an EVM-compatible Layer-1 blockchain, it provides an open, decentralized infrastructure for sports and entertainment brands to build on. The technology is designed for scalability, speed, and security, ideal for large volumes of fan engagement.

It runs on a Proof-of-Staked Authority (PoSA) consensus mechanism, ensuring high throughput with low transaction costs. It is important in sports, where thousands of fans might interact with a platform simultaneously, whether it’s to collect digital memorabilia, participate in team decisions, or access loyalty perks.

From Fan Polls to Node Validators: A New Level of Partnership

In the early days, blockchain in sports meant simple fan polls or gamified apps. In 2025, Chiliz is helping sports brands take a much bigger role. Now, elite teams are stepping up as node validators on the Chiliz Chain. It’s a powerful shift that makes them part of the ecosystem’s very foundation.

Being a validator means running a node that helps verify transactions and keep the chain secure. For sports teams, this is more than a technical job; it’s a statement. It shows they’re not just blockchain users, but contributors to its growth and success.

Case Study: Paris Saint-Germain (PSG)

Paris Saint-Germain became one of the first elite clubs to take this step. In late 2024, PSG joined as a validator, showing deep trust in the Chiliz Chain. Their participation enhances credibility, visibility, and fan trust across the ecosystem. It’s a major vote of confidence from a globally recognized football club and sends a clear message that Web3 isn’t just a trend, it’s a strategic priority.

Case Study: TokenPost

In June 2025, South Korean media group TokenPost became a validator as well. This move expands Chiliz Chain’s reach into Asia, an important region for blockchain innovation. Having media validators also increases transparency and decentralization, giving fans and developers even more confidence in the chain’s growth.

Expanding Utility: Digital Collectibles and Real-World Rewards

Beyond governance, teams are using Chiliz Chain to create new kinds of value for fans. In May 2025, PSG launched exclusive digital collectibles and “memory tickets” for stadium tour guests through its Concorde platform. These tokens offer fans something permanent and verifiable, a new kind of souvenir that’s both meaningful and modern.

Case Study: FintSport

One standout project is FintSport, co-founded by former football star Juan Pablo Sorín. This platform allows athletes and teams to issue “Player Tokens,” offering fans a new way to support and engage with their favourite players.

FintSport came through the Chiliz Includ3d Accelerator and officially launched in June 2025. It is a clear example of how Chiliz is guiding startups from concept to live deployment, proving that the ecosystem is a fertile ground for real, impactful innovation.

Navigating Regulation and Targeting New Frontiers

Chiliz is strategically positioning itself for the next phase of global expansion. The launch of “Chiliz Sports” in late 2024 is a key step in that direction. This new division acts as a bridge between the crypto world and traditional sports. It offers consulting, education, and matchmaking services for potential partners.

Competitive Landscape

While other blockchains also work with sports-related projects, Chiliz stands out for its laser focus. It’s not trying to serve every industry; it’s built specifically for sports and entertainment. With more than 150 official team partnerships and growing validator support, it already holds a strong leadership position.
